首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用多行文本框的值作为文件名vba创建文本文件

VBA(Visual Basic for Applications)是一种用于Microsoft Office应用程序的编程语言,可以通过VBA编写宏来自动化执行各种任务。在VBA中,可以使用多行文本框的值作为文件名来创建文本文件。

创建文本文件的步骤如下:

  1. 首先,需要在VBA中声明一个变量来存储多行文本框的值,可以使用字符串类型的变量。
代码语言:txt
复制
Dim fileName As String
  1. 然后,将多行文本框的值赋给这个变量。
代码语言:txt
复制
fileName = TextBox1.Value

这里假设多行文本框的名称为"TextBox1",可以根据实际情况进行修改。

  1. 接下来,可以使用VBA的文件操作函数来创建文本文件并将多行文本框的值写入文件中。可以使用VBA的Open语句来打开一个文件,使用Print语句将文本写入文件,最后使用Close语句关闭文件。
代码语言:txt
复制
Dim fileNumber As Integer
fileNumber = FreeFile

Open fileName For Output As fileNumber
Print #fileNumber, TextBox1.Value
Close fileNumber

在上述代码中,首先使用FreeFile函数获取一个可用的文件号,然后使用Open语句打开一个文件,使用Print语句将多行文本框的值写入文件,最后使用Close语句关闭文件。

需要注意的是,上述代码中的文件名是使用多行文本框的值作为文件名来创建文本文件的。如果多行文本框的值包含特殊字符或无效字符,需要进行适当的处理,例如替换掉这些特殊字符或无效字符。

关于VBA的更多信息和学习资源,可以参考腾讯云的VBA开发文档:VBA开发文档

请注意,以上答案仅供参考,具体实现方式可能因实际情况而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券